  1. The features of 1950s prom dress

    • Layers of tulle and snug princess cut bodices characterized formal 1950s prom gowns. These dresses were floor-length or tea-length, and they were made of finer materials than classic swing dresses. Pink was the most popular prom color, but other bright or pastel hues were also popular. ...
    • The wide, fluffy, tea-length skirt was one of the hallmarks of classic 1950s prom dresses.
